Output e44665ed3bca5c563cd666df28193b23e17cb8da77eec49a76401dccd245aeb8:1

value
194103504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ac7fef925ab2d9a222fe305b6c0c7e638a7c653 OP_EQUAL
address
3ELpkysKfWX9cg7gPo2Fw5mXz9uiow3tYd
transaction
e44665ed3bca5c563cd666df28193b23e17cb8da77eec49a76401dccd245aeb8
spent
true